Need help with this problem h+-3=4 please

Respuesta :

MattPL
MattPL MattPL
  • 08-07-2019

Answer:

h=7

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]h+(-3)=4[/tex]

may be rewritten as

[tex]h-3=4[/tex]

as adding a negative is the same as subtracting a positive.

To solve, add 3 to both sides.

[tex]h-3=4\\h=7[/tex]
